Individuals who are affected by limb loss have renewed assurance that clinics devoted to running and mobility will continue to be supported under a recent agreement between prosthetics manufacturer, Össur, Foothill Ranch, Calif, and the San Diego, Calif-based Challenged Athletes Foundation. According to a media release from CAF the multi-year global sponsorship agreement sustains a long-standing effort between the two organizations that to support people affected by limb loss.

Ossur chief executive officer Jon Sigurdsson stated in the media release that Ossur and CAF has worked jointly for more than 20 years to improve the lives of people with lower-limb loss with the aim of helping them experience the benefits of “life without limitations.”

“We are pleased to be continuing our collaboration with CAF by extending this agreement and increasing our overall support for this valued partner,” Sigurdsson adds.

Perhaps the most notable windfall of the Össur-CAF agreement is a series of Össur Running and Mobility Clinics, presented by CAF. These clinics are conducted annually across the United Staes, and feature amputee rehabilitation experts Bob Gailey and Peter Harsch. Gailey and Harsch work to teach amputees at varying levels of ability how to achieve their mobility goals, according to the Ossur media release.

Participants are said to work side-by-side with volunteer clinical professionals and world-class parathletes in a safe and encouraging environment, learning proper running form and techniques through what is described as “fun drills and exercises.” Ossur reports that in 2014, more than 300 participants attended the clinics.

“CAF is dedicated to helping people with physical challenges live full, active lives through participation in fitness activities and competitive sports,” says Virginia Tinley, CAF’s Executive Director. “The Össur Running and Mobility Clinics we present are a wonderful means of fulfilling our organization’s mission, and we are pleased to be continuing this collaboration, so that even more amputees may benefit from the right to participate in physical activities.”

So far six Össur-CAF clinics have been confirmed for 2015. Among sites that have already been named are Washington DC, New York, Tucson, Ariz, Boston, San Francisco, and San Diego. According to the Ossur media release, participation at all Össur Running and Mobility Clinics presented by CAF is free, however, advance registration is required for attendees and volunteers.
